Hi, welcome aboard. Quick summary before I'm out: the Pipewren notification fan-out has been hitting queue saturation during evening peaks, so we added backpressure — producers now respect a credit window from the dispatcher. The config lives in the `fanout-limits` bundle and ships with each release. Watch the saturation dashboard for the first two deploys; if credits drop below 10%, roll back. You'll need to sign the limits bundle yourself when cutting a release. The deploy key you should use is below.

release key, bawig-kahip: bky4_bSxn

**SEATR-912: Seat map renders overlapping rows**

Product: Velvetine seat-map renderer, Orpheum layout.

Repro: open venue layout, zoom to balcony, toggle accessibility view. Rows K–M overlap; seats unclickable. Occurs on layouts with curved balconies only. Affects checkout — customers report blocked purchases. Workaround: refresh clears it once. To pull the failing layout JSON from the staging API, authenticate with the bearer token below.

portal login ticket: eyJhbGciOiJIUzI1NiIsInR5cCI6IkpXVCJ9.eyJzdWIiOiIMjvRAf3PEFIn0.nuv9gjixLtnr

Ticket: Staging env misconfigured for Siftgate bloom filter

The bloom layer in front of the Pellet KV store is rejecting all lookups in staging because the env file was copied from the dev template without credentials. False-positive tuning values are fine; only the auth line is missing. To unblock the weekly demo, the Pellet admission secret must be set on the following line.

env line for yaguf-fajop: LEDGER_TOKEN13=fb08984397349

## 3.2.0 — Changed defaults

The Kerbstone address autocomplete widget now debounces keystrokes at 250 ms instead of 100 ms, and the minimum query length rose from two characters to three. Both changes reduce load on the suggestion backend, which was the source of last month's paging storms. If you are on call and see a spike in empty-result complaints, check whether a tenant has overridden these settings. For reference, the new default configuration values ship as follows.

service settings:
OLIATH_HOST=oliath.tolvaqlabs.internal
OLIATH_PORT=6379